Hexagram 13: Fellowship with Others Changing to Hexagram 62: Preponderance of the Small

I Ching casting meaning · Tong RenXiao Guo

The grand shared vision now has to survive contact with the small print. Preponderance of the Small announces a season where details carry more weight than declarations — and where the fellowship's health shows in tiny things: who follows up, who remembers the name, whether the message gets answered today or eventually. What changes is altitude: fly low, like the small bird; big gestures and sweeping initiatives will miss, while careful micro-execution lands. Concrete implication: audit the small promises your group has made and close every open loop — the unpaid invoice of attention, the unreturned call, the unproofread document. This season, greatness hides in follow-through measured in centimeters.

A casting that moves from Fellowship with Others into Preponderance of the Small means the situation you asked about is not static — it begins as one pattern and resolves into another. The first hexagram describes where you stand; the second describes where events are carrying you.

13. Fellowship with OthersTong Ren · Fire below Heaven
62. Preponderance of the SmallXiao Guo · Mountain below Thunder

Highlighted in red: lines 1, 5 and 6 are moving — counted from the bottom. A moving line is where the change is actually happening: it flips from yang to yin or back, and that flip is what turns Fellowship with Others into Preponderance of the Small.

The situation: Hexagram 13, Fellowship with Others

Open fellowship. Shared purpose beats private interest.

Fire rising toward open sky — warmth meant to be shared, light meant for everyone. This hexagram favors the commons: the group project, the public cause, the collaboration where credit gets spread around. The test is whether your fellowship is real — open to outsiders, honest about motives — or just a clique with better branding. Private deals and inside baseball corrode fast right now. Work in the open, share the upside, and align with people around a purpose bigger than any of you. What you build together this season outlasts what you'd build alone.

Structurally, Fellowship with Others is Fire below Heaven — the inner state meeting the outer condition. That pairing is the lens for everything above.

Where it's heading: Hexagram 62, Preponderance of the Small

Small exceeds big this season. Sweat the details, stay low.

The changed hexagram is the trajectory, not a verdict. As the moving lines settle, the energy of Fellowship with Others gives way to Preponderance of the Small (Xiao Guo) — Mountain below Thunder. The advice that belongs to this outcome: Fly low and sweat details. Small done excellently beats big done loudly.
